Mediterranean Quinoa Salad
Mediterranean Quinoa Salad is a healthy vegetarian side dish loaded with fresh t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, olives, feta, basil, quinoa and brown rice!
- 2 4.9 oz boxes quinoa and brown rice blend (Near East Brand)
- 3 cups water
- 2 teaspo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on oregano
- 1/4 to 1/2 teaspoon chili flakes
- 1 large cucumber peeled and diced
- 3 roma tomatoes diced
- 1/2 red onion diced
- 1/2 cup sliced black olives
- 1/4 cup fresh basil chopped
- 1/2 cup feta cheese
- 1/4 to 1/2 cup balsamic vinaigrette
Bring the water, oil and salt to a boil. Stir in the quinoa and brown rice (discarding the seasoning blend from the box, we don't need those). Lower the flame and simmer, uncovered, until the water has absorbed and the grains are tender. Remove from heat and allow to cool down.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ooled grains, chopped veggies, feta, and basil. Toss to fully combine. Drizzle in as much or as little of the vinaigrette as you'd like and season with dried oregano and chili flakes. Serve cold or at room temperature. Will keep in the fridge for up to 2 days.
